
GW INSTEK AFG-2125
The GW INSTEK AFG-2125 is a DDS-based arbitrary waveform function generator for building and testing signals in the laboratory and in electronics production. It is used when a controlled test signal is required instead of working with a fixed, natural signal from a circuit or sensor.
It can generate sine, square, ramp/triangle, noise, and arbitrary waveforms. For sine, square, and triangle, the frequency range is from 0.1 Hz to 25 MHz, and the frequency can be set with 0.1 Hz resolution. This makes it easier to fine-tune signals when testing circuits, measuring responses, or simulating a specific signal form.
The unit has a 20 MSa/s sample rate, 10-bit amplitude resolution, and 4k-point waveform memory for arbitrary signals. This means that users can work with their own waveforms and send them out through the main output with a 50 Ω output impedance. The amplitude is specified from 1 mVpp to 5 Vpp in 50 Ω, or 2 mVpp to 10 Vpp without load.
On the front, there is a 3.5" LCD display, allowing settings and signal parameters to be read directly. There is also a USB device interface for remote control and for downloading waveform data from a PC. The modulation functions AM, FM, and FSK, as well as sweep, make it useful when the signal needs to be varied over time in a test setup.
The manufacturer's documentation also states that the AFG-2125 is supplied in the AFG-2100/2000 series, and that the manufacturer provides a datasheet and software for waveform editing on a PC.
